摘要
AIM: To evaluate the midterm outcomes of penetrating keratoplasty(PK) following allogeneic cultivated limbal epithelial transplantation(CLET) for bilateral total limbal stem cell deficiency(LSCD). METHODS: Ten patients(10 eyes) with bilateral LSCD were enrolled in this prospective noncomparative case series study. Each participant underwent PK approximately 6 mo after a CLET. Topical tacrolimus, topical and systemic steroids, and oral ciclosporin were administered postoperatively. Best-corrected visual acuity(BCVA), intraocular pressure(IOP), ocular surface grading scores(OSS), corneal graft epithelial rehabilitation, persistent epithelial defect(PED), immunological rejection, and graft survival rate were assessed. RESULTS: The time interval between PK and allogeneic CLET was 6.90±1.29(6-10)mo. BCVA improved from 2.46±0.32 log MAR preoperatively to 0.77±0.55 log MAR post-PK(P<0.001). Kaplan-Meier analysis of mean graft survival revealed graft survival rates of 100% at 12 and 24 mo and 80.0% at 36 mo. PEDs appeared in 5 eyes at different periods post-PK, and graft rejection occurred in 4 eyes. The total OSS decreased from 12.4±4.4 before allogeneic CLET to 1.4±1.51 after PK. CONCLUSION: A sequential therapy design of PK following allogeneic CLET can maintain a stable ocular surface with improved BCVA despite the relatively high graft rejection rate.
